February 2, 2019 - According to a Netscribes’ report published on Research on Global Markets, the global over the air testing market is expected to have a considerable compound annual growth rate (CAGR) of 10.13% and reach a market size of USD 1.77 Bn by 2023.

According to the report, over the air (OTA) testing is required by standards organizations, regulatory bodies, carriers, and merchants to examine the performance, proficiency, safety, and reliability of wireless devices in the real world. OTA testing is utilized by regulatory bodies such as the Cellular Telecommunications and Internet Association (CTIA) and mobile network operator (MNO).
The global over the air testing market is segmented based on application, communication technology, and region.

The same report suggests that the media and entertainment sector will expand at a CAGR of 11.4% during the 2018-2023 period. Increasing adoption of autonomous and connected cars has led to a boost in OTA testing in automotive and transformation industry. OTA testing is expected to see further growth due to the accelerated adoption of Internet of Things. Pre-compliance testing for the rapidly-evolving 5G technology will also play a major role in the growth of OTA testing as a service. The growth of smart cities and increase in the use of smart devices such as smart watches, medical devices and fitness wearables connected using wireless devices such as Bluetooth, Wi-Fi, and cellular devices will fuel the growth of the OTA testing market.

Geographically, the global over the air testing market is segmented into North America, Europe, Asia-Pacific, Latin America, and the Middle East and Africa. The Asia Pacific is showing the maximum growth potential, followed by North America and Europe. Huge investments in the machine to machine (M2M) communication and the implementation of Internet of Things in India, Japan, China, and South Korea along with the increased use of telecommunication devices such as smartphones, laptops, and computers are the reason behind the strong growth of OTA testing in the Asia Pacific region. In Europe, the creation of the Alliance for Internet of Things Innovation (AIOTI) by the European Commission and increase in government spending on the Internet of Things in North America has resulted in the growth of the global OTA testing market.
